Position Overview
The Manufacturing Supervisor may be assigned to work directly with Upstream, Downstream or Buffer Preparation Unit Operations. This individual will supervise a team of employees directly or indirectly in these production process units.Company Overview

Operational oversight of the following systems dependent upon assignment: Upstream Unit:- Single-Use Cell Culture Vessels/Bioreactors up to 2000L
- Bacterial Fermentation Culture Vessels up to 2000L
- Alpha Wasserman Continuous Flow Centrifuges
- Disposable Magnetic Mixing Bags and Totes
- Cell Expansion and Propagation
- Banking/Cryopreservation of Cell Lines and Viruses
- Hyperstack, Cellstack and other adherent cell technologies
- Plate counting, microscopic examination
- Monitor cultures, take samples, turn-around of bioreactor and fermenters, sterilization, and inoculation
- Medium to Large-scale filtration systems including Tangential Flow Filtration (TFF) Hollow Fiber Tangential Flow Filtration (HFTFF), Nanofiltration and depth filtration.
- Medium to Large-scale Chromatographic systems (ÄKTA)
- Pre-Packed Columns from 1L to 100L
- Single use mixing systems (Pall & GE)
- Single Use connectivity types such as GE DAC and Colder AseptiQuik
- Plate counting, microscopic examination
- Monitor cultures, take samples, turn-around of bioreactor and fermenters, sterilization, and inoculation
- Bulk filling
- Aseptic process simulation and drug product filling
- Preparation of medium from stock raw materials including the compounding, mixing, testing and filtration for further process needs
- Preparation of buffers from stock raw materials including the compounding, mixing, testing and filtration for further process needs
- Weighing of raw materials per batch record specifications and assignment of appropriate expiry per procedures
- Integrity testing of filters
